WebGenerally speaking, surgery isn’t recommended for ovarian cysts unless they’re larger than 50 to 60 millimeters (mm) (about 2 to 2.4 inches) in size. However, this guideline can vary. For instance, a simple cyst may be left alone until it’s 10 cm (4 inches) in size. And cancerous cysts may be removed when they’re much smaller.

Abdominal bloating. theyarddept yahoo.comWeb16 sept. 2010 · A mural nodule is a small growth on the wall of the cyst. Usually simple cysts are filled only with fluid and they have thin walls (this can be seen on the ultrasound). Complex cysts have some kind of solid component inside them, such as a calcification (like teeth in a dermoid cyst for example) or some kind of tissue. safety one source
